National Guardsman Tests Positive for Malaria

A National Guardsman stationed in Cameron County has been identified as the individual who tested positive for malaria after being heavily bitten by bugs, including mosquitoes, during a border security assignment. The Guardsman experienced symptoms within two weeks and it took two trips to the hospital to receive a malaria diagnosis.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ention is monitoring four other cases of malaria in Florida, while health officials in Cameron County are testing mosquitoes to determine if they are carrying the virus.

Tunisia Identifies Synagogue Gunman and Confirms Premeditated Attack.

The Tunisian national guardsman who killed five people in an attack on the Ghriba synagogue on the island of Djerba targeted the shrine in a premeditated act, according to Tunisia's interior minister. The gunman, Wissam Khazri, was a member of the Tunisian National Guard affiliated with the naval center in the island’s port town of Aghir. The attack, which killed three police officers and two visitors, was not immediately classified as terrorism. The motive for the attack is still under investigation.

Graham criticizes Greene for defending classified document leak.

Senator Lindsey Graham criticized Representative Marjorie Taylor Greene for defending the National Guardsman suspected of leaking classified documents online. Graham called Greene's comments "irresponsible" and stated that military members are now less safe because of the leak. The leak potentially has serious implications for Ukrainians on the battlefield and has frustrated several U.S. allies. The National Guardsman, Jack Teixeira, was charged with unauthorized retention and transmission of classified national defense information.

Discord's Role in the Pentagon Leaks and Its Fallout

Discord is a messaging platform used by almost 200 million people online, primarily by gamers to communicate with each other. However, it has also become a space for social media and extremist groups to communicate and organize. The recent Pentagon leak was reportedly posted inside a private Discord server accessible by just a couple dozen users. Discord has a zero-tolerance policy against hate or violent extremism and takes action when it becomes aware of it, including banning users, shutting down servers, and engaging with authorities when appropriate.

National Guardsman arrested for leaking classified documents online.

The FBI has arrested a 21-year-old member of the US Air National Guard, Jack Douglas Teixeira, for leaking classified documents online that embarrassed Washington with allies around the world. Teixeira was arrested at his home in Dighton, Massachusetts, and is expected to face criminal charges of willfully retaining and transmitting national defense information, which could carry up to 10 years' imprisonment. The leak of documents, believed to be the most serious security breach since WikiLeaks in 2010, revealed US spying on allies and purported Ukrainian military vulnerabilities.
